The famous Tsukiji Fish Market is located near our guesthouse. The Osakana Hukyu Center, where you can apply for the tour of tuna auctions, is only one minutes walk away.
The time for application is 5:00 a.m. Tourists may visit the market daily between 5:25 a.m. and 6:15 a.m. Only 120 people are allowed in the market per day.
The queuing starts at 4:00 a.m. daily. Its convenient to go there from our guesthouse.
